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ations And Comparisons

  • Weight capacity: Most extenders in this review offer 750 lbs, with some models advertising up to 800 lbs. Assess your typical loads (lumber, ladders, boats) and choose a rating that provides a safety margin for dynamic loads during travel.
  • Hitch compatibility: All highlighted products fit 2″ receivers. If your vehicle uses a different hitch size, consider adaptors or alternative models with broader compatibility.
  • Adjustability: Width and height ranges vary. Wider ranges help accommodate bulky items; taller extensions may require extra clearance and may affect vehicle handling and rear visibility.
  • Foldability and storage: Foldable designs save space in garages and driveways. If storage space is tight, prioritize models with compact folded dimensions and quick-release mechanisms.
  • 2-in-1 design: Many extenders can operate horizontally or vertically. Decide which orientation best suits your load profile and vehicle configuration, and verify stability under the intended load.
  • Stability features: Stabilizer kits, straps, or stabilizer bars reduce sway when hauling long cargo. Look for models that include or support these accessories for safer transport.
  • Safety and visibility: Reflectors and flags improve visibility for long payloads extending beyond the tailgate. This is particularly important for highway travel and nighttime use.
  • Durability: Steel construction, coating (powder-coated finishes), and corrosion resistance contribute to longer service life in varied weather conditions. Consider environments where exposure to moisture, salt, or road debris is common.
  • Installation and maintenance: Quick-release pins, hardware quality, and clear assembly instructions influence setup time. Regularly inspect pins, welds, and locking mechanisms for wear and tightness.
